Help us create a fun, artsy event to fundraise for The Arts Council of West Chester & Liberty

The Arts Council of West Chester & Liberty OH is seeking volunteers to be a part of our Development Committee. Your role would be to us plan a great fundraising gala to bring the Arts to our community.

You don't need to be an Artist! We need people who love to put on a great party!

We provide an art show, an Arts Sampler day, student Arts scholarships, a Shakespeare Arts Festival and other programs to give our Artists opportunities and to bring the Arts to our communitiy.

Mission Statement

Our mission is to benefit and inspire the community through the Arts.

Description

The Arts Council of West Chester & Liberty’s mission is to benefit and inspire the community through Art. We carry out our mission by providing Arts programing, creating opportunities for local artists and acting as advocates for the Arts in our community. The Arts are essential to a dynamic and thriving community. We strive to envolve all community members including individuals, families, small business, corporations and community organizations and adminastration.
